#1c5be8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c5be8 is composed of 11% red, 35.7%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 51%. #1c5be8 color hex could be obtained by blending #38b6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#1c5be8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1c5be8 has RGB values of R:28, G:91,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1858536.

Shades and Tints of #1c5be8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000205 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c5be8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8088 is the less saturated color, while #0954fb is the most saturated one.
